Open your Etsy shop

First, you need to open a shop on Etsy. This is the only way for potential customers to find your shop and purchase items from it. When creating an Etsy account and store, consider optimizing all aspects of your page. This includes your pictures, titles, descriptions, and tags. That way, customers can discover your page more easily.

Create your invitation designs

Once your store is up and running, you need to start creating your invitation designs. Remember to focus on quality over quantity. Potential customers will be drawn in by the beauty of your creations. Also, take advantage of sites like Canva and Adobe Creative Cloud to create high-quality designs.

You can create all different types of invitations. Some of your options include the following:

– Baby shower invitations

– Wedding invitations

– Birthday party invitations

– Graduation announcements

– Anniversary party invitations

– Summer barbeques

– Holiday parties

– Bat and bar mitzvahs

– Baptisms, first communions, and confirmations

– And more!

Set a fair price

Setting a price for your invitations is an important factor. Your pricing can either make or break your shop. Etsy takes 3.5% of each sale. So you should set prices that cover those fees and still allow you to profit from every transaction. Research other sellers’ pricing models before setting yours. And remember, don’t undersell yourself! You want customers to feel like they’re getting a good deal while you’re still earning money.

Advertise your shop

The next step is to draw attention to your Etsy store. You can use a variety of methods such as posting on social media, running ads, or creating blog posts about your shop. Additionally, make sure to keep customers informed about new designs and sales that you offer. Word-of-mouth marketing also plays a big role in driving traffic to your store. So don’t forget to reach out to family and friends who may be interested in supporting you.

Follow up with customers

Try to follow up with customers after they purchase an invitation from you. Make sure your customers are satisfied with their purchases and offer help if needed. This will improve customer satisfaction and may encourage people to buy from your store again.
